Suresh Prabhu gets additional charge of Civil Aviation

Date:

The Commerce Minister, Suresh Prabhu has been assigned additional charge of Civil Aviation Ministry. The post was vacated by the Telugu Desam Party’s Ashok Gajapathi Raju last week.

Raju had vacated the position to protest on the Centre’s refusal to give Andhra Pradesh “special status”. No declarations of who will take over from Raju was made at the time the PM had accepted his resignation.

The news was Tweeted by President Ram Nath Kovind’s office.

Suresh Prabhu had been shifted to the Commerce Ministry from the Railway Ministry in September 2017 after he took “full moral responsibility” for a string of rail accidents that happened under his charge.

The Commerce Ministry is the ninth Cabinet-level position that Mr Prabhu has held in his political career where he has served first Shiv Sena and then BJP.
